How Long Will Tekken: Bloodline Be?
Tekken: Bloodline, the Netflix original anime series, has sparked a lot of interest among fans of the Tekken franchise. The show premiered on August 18, 2022, with six episodes, leaving many wondering how long the series will be. In this article, we will dive into the details of Tekken: Bloodline’s length, potential renewal, and more.
Direct Answer:
As of now, Tekken: Bloodline has six episodes, which is a relatively short season compared to other anime series. There has been no official announcement from Netflix or the creators of the show regarding the number of seasons or episodes to come. However, considering the show’s popularity and the story’s potential for expansion, it’s possible that we might see more episodes or seasons in the future.
